Output 72f0e805aa563ffbe793ff7cc310657d6a019b7d103c9e74b04e63075bf38c92:6

value
23392698
script pubkey
OP_0 OP_PUSHBYTES_20 db21e97b8ed5b50fb9281565f4e912d192da656f
address
bc1qmvs7j7uw6k6slwfgz4jlf6gj6xfd5et0j4htpn
transaction
72f0e805aa563ffbe793ff7cc310657d6a019b7d103c9e74b04e63075bf38c92
spent
true